Я пытаюсь загрузить файл Excel, используя OpenPyxl в Python. < /p>
from openpyxl import load_workbook
wb2 = load_workbook('Book1.xlsx')
print wb2.get_sheet_names()
< /code>
Это только эти три строки. и он бросает следующую ошибку: < /p>
Traceback (most recent call last):
File "C:/Python27/excel1.py", line 5, in
wb2 = load_workbook('Book1.xlsx')
File "C:\Python27\Lib\site-packages\openpyxl\reader\excel.py", line 141, in load_workbook
archive = ZipFile(f, 'r', ZIP_DEFLATED)
File "C:\Python27\Lib\zipfile.py", line 793, in __init__
self._RealGetContents()
File "C:\Python27\Lib\zipfile.py", line 835, in _RealGetContents
raise BadZipfile, "File is not a zip file"
BadZipfile: File is not a zip file
< /code>
Это точно так же, как их документация. https://openpyxl.readthedocs.org/en/lat ... orial.html
- это их лучший пакет для этого.
Подробнее здесь: https://stackoverflow.com/questions/299 ... h-openpyxl